Better News: Post and Courier philanthropic effort nets $1 million

Like many newspapers, The Post and Courier  was experiencing a drop-off in local advertising spending, which meant diminishing revenues. However, the Charleston, South Carolina, daily decided to adjust course and focus on philanthropy as a way to pay for its journalism.

The new fundraising model proved so successful that The Post and Courier was able to raise $1 million to support a statewide investigative fund and education lab.

Executive Editor Autumn Phillips recently wrote a report for API’s Better News initiative about The Post and Courier’s stellar fundaising effort. She shares the details with host Michael O’Connell on the latest episode of the Better News podcast.
